Technical characteristics of the accelerator pedal assembly
The presented assembly belongs to the Pedals, pedal pads and footrests category and is a complete, electronic accelerator pedal unit. The “drive-by-wire” design eliminates the traditional throttle cable, utilizing a pedal position sensor and integrated electronics to generate a signal for the engine control unit. As a result, the system reacts predictably, and torque control is more precise.
The component was developed by the vehicle manufacturer, which means it maintains factory geometry, proper pedal travel, and resistance characteristics. This makes it easier for the driver to modulate acceleration, especially in urban conditions, during maneuvers in tight spaces, and when driving with a load.
Vehicle function and benefits of use
The accelerator pedal assembly in the Ford Transit MK7 plays a key role in the communication between the driver and the drivetrain. It is responsible for:
- converting the driver’s foot movement into an electrical signal with the appropriate range,
- maintaining a stable pedal position during long-distance driving,
- cooperating with engine control systems, such as traction control or torque limiters.
Replacing a worn or damaged pedal with an original assembly ensures consistency with the factory ECU software, which reduces the risk of errors, jerking during acceleration, or incorrect throttle response. For commercial vehicles like the Transit, this has a direct impact on driver comfort and the predictability of the vehicle’s behavior under load.

Condition, installation, and service application
This is a used part, intended as a service replacement in the event of failure, mechanical wear, or issues with the pedal position sensor. Using an original accelerator pedal assembly reduces the risk of improper drivetrain operation that may occur with low-quality components.
In workshop practice, replacing the throttle pedal assembly is a typical repair procedure in situations where errors related to the pedal position signal, uneven acceleration response, or engine limp mode occur. Using a complete assembly shortens repair time and simplifies diagnostics, as it eliminates the need to interfere with individual sub-components.
